Author: Neshat, Shirin
In her latest body of work, multimedia artist Shirin Neshat turns her focus to the American West. With more than 100 photographs, a two-channel video installation and a feature film, Neshat creates a multilayered look at contemporary America through the eyes of a fictionalised artist. Monumental black-and-white photographs are transformed through Neshat's use of Farsi text and hand-drawn images, which represent Neshat's interpretation of the dreams of the sitter.Neshat works and experiments with photography, video and film, imbuing them with highly poetic and politically charged images and narratives that question issues of power, religion, race, gender and the relationship between the past and present, occident and orient, individual and collective through the lens of her personal experiences as an Iranian woman living in exile.
ISBN 9781955161091. Radius Books/SITE Santa Fe. hb. 160 pages. 90 colour ills. 30 x 24 cm.
